jquery-ujs-это ненавязчивая реализация, позволяющая использовать jQuery в приложении Rails. Проще говоря, это всего лишь один rails.js. Чтобы использовать его, вам нужно получить jQuery и настроить...
ваша проблема в том, что jquery не возвращает правильный размер вашего элемента ( $(this).width() ). попробуйте использовать функцию getBoundingClientRect (см. это ), чтобы получить объект...
Я не тестировал его, но это, вероятно, должно сработать: Скажите, что у вас есть аккордеон с id #accordion $('#accordion').append('<h3><a href=#>New...
var userDetailsFields = $(formSelector).find(input[type='text'], select).map(function(){ return this.id; }); .each используется для итерации по массиву и создания чего-то на каждом элементе. Это...
Вместо использования document ready вы можете создать закрытие (в конце body ), например: (function($) { //jQuery stuff $('.elem') // $ refers to jQuery })(jQuery); Если я правильно понял ваш вопрос
На самом деле это не должно вызывать фокусировку на базовом элементе HTML. Попробуй $('#SecLoginP ...').get(0).focus(); Это сбивает с толку, но $(elem).focus() запускает события фокусировки,...
$(this) в ok: function(){} ссылается на диалоговое окно, и поэтому он не может удалить div .row . Имейте ссылку на .row во время detach.click() и используйте ее на ok: function(){} . Вот обновленное...
Vanilla JavaScript всегда быстрее, чем jQuery, но так как jQuery для ID селекторов использует родную функцию getElementById , нет никакой основной разницы между ними, вы также можете использовать...
вы можете использовать его .trigger() функция доступна в библиотеке jquery, чтобы сделать это. Пример $( #foo ).on( click, function() { alert( $( this ).text() ); }); $( #foo ).trigger( click ); вы...
new -это зарезервированное ключевое слово в javascript (оно используется в качестве синтаксиса для создания новых объектов), поэтому вы не можете использовать его в качестве имени функции....
Ваши данные являются массивом объектов и имеют данные по индексам 0,1,2 и так далее, так что вам нужно пробовать console.log(data[0].first_name); вы также можете сделать петлю через них for(var...
Похоже, вы запускаете событие в своем готовом блоке, а не связываете его. Вы можете использовать bind, или, еще лучше, делегировать. Кроме того, избегайте вызова $() более одного раза: $(function()...
Если вы используете AJAX для перезагрузки содержимого представления с сервера, то когда этот AJAX завершится успешно, поскольку вы воссоздаете DOM, вам нужно будет снова подключить datepicker....
Правильно, похоже, что есть ошибка с последней версией qTip, есть немного обсуждения об этом . Один из людей, которые комментируют назад, предложил использовать другую версию (build, whatever)...
Я сделал следующее, что я держу jquery ссылку от sapui5 <script src=resources/sap-ui-core.js id=sap-ui-bootstrap data-sap-ui-libs=sap.ui.commons,sap.ui.table data-sap-ui-theme=sap_bluecrystal>...
Проблема в том, что вы включаете файлы скриптов jQuery несколько раз. В частности, причиной вашей проблемы является то, что вы загружаете jQuery один раз после загрузки плагина LavaLamp, тем самым...
Короче говоря, они служат разным целям, поэтому ответом будет вариант a combination of both for various situations. Основные правила таковы: .ajaxComplete() -выполняется для каждого завершенного...
Используйте метод eq() : $(.myClass).eq(0) Это возвращает объект jQuery, в то время как .get() возвращает элемент DOM. .eq() позволяет указать индекс, но если вы просто хотите первый , вы можете...
Вы забыли включить код, который фактически устанавливает значение jQuery-data в Предыдущее значение! Проверьте это решение: http://jsfiddle.net/uW2ND/2 /
Я обнаружил, что по состоянию на август 2012 года, самая последняя версия этого конкретного плагина на самом деле требует jQuery 1.7.2 или выше, чтобы работать. Документация кажется немного...